How it works
The motor is the main component of a robotic vacuum, as it creates suction to draw dirt and debris in the vacuum bag. Some robot cleaners have a combination of roller brushes, a side brush and mops to agitate and raise particles into the suction. Some come with smart features, like the ability to auto return to the dock once it is full and recharge. Certain models have voice activation as well as smart home integration. You can control the machine using your smartphone’s app or personal assistant.
Sensors help robots navigate their environment by avoiding obstacles and tense corners. Sensors such as obstacles and cliff sensors are used to prevent robots from falling down stairs or getting stuck under furniture. Certain robots have dirt sensors that alert you when the robot is dirty and requires to be cleaned. Many modern robot vacuums include smart features such as intelligent mapping, smart mops, and mops which can distinguish between carpets and hard floors.
Some robot vacuums that also have mop attachments come with a docking station that can automatically empty the bin, clean mop pads and replenish the water. Certain robot vacuums that have mops can perform two tasks simultaneously, including vacuuming and cleaning. They can also be set up to clean a certain area or room in your home on a consistent schedule. For example, you could program your robot to vacuum and clean the living area every morning and evening throughout the week.

Cleaning time
Most robot vacuum cleaners have a dust bin and water reservoir that needs to be emptied however, mop robots also have to have their cleaning pads cleaned and this can increase the total running time of the device. The time required to clean a room could also be affected by how many obstacles the robot encounters, whether it has to push furniture, avoid shoes and socks, or find its way around messy rooms.
Some robotic vacuums and mop systems are able to detect carpets and alter their power settings to suit. However, they may leave behind some dirt, particularly on high-pile or shag rugs. Some models require more power to navigate through carpets that are very thick, which can drain batteries faster.
Other factors can impact the performance of a robot, such as the condition of its accessories and the frequency at which it has to be serviced. A tangled or clogged brush can hinder the robot from performing its task. A dirty or full filter can cause it to overheat and even disconnect from the Internet.

Cleaning Area
Robots that have mopping capabilities, unlike vacuum-only models, utilize cleaning soap and water to soften staining. The brushes or pads that are used to collect dirt need to be regularly cleaned or machine-washed. Replacements may be required at some point. You’ll have to include these costs into your budget.
Despite these disadvantages, an automated mop and vacuum combination can be a valuable addition to your household’s cleaning equipment. For example, if you have carpets in addition to hard flooring, the robot can clean them and then mop any remaining dirty spots which aren’t eliminated by simply sweep. If you have both tile floors and wood floors, the robot will ensure that no stones are left behind during the mopping process and tiles aren’t damaged by the water or cleaning solution.
A good mopping device is one that has an automated navigation system that determines each room’s location and the exact location to do its job effectively. It should also be able to avoid obstacles, such as wires and furniture. It’s recommended to select a model that has clever features that allow you to monitor your cleaning robot, such as an interactive dashboard that shows the progress of a mopping session and an application that lets you set “no-go zones” so it can’t navigate through those areas.

All robot vacuum cleaners uk vacuums and mops need regular maintenance. This includes emptying the bin, cleaning filters and changing filters and bags. Also, you’ll need to clean the sensors often to aid in navigation, and empty and rinse the tank of water and clean the filter. You’ll need to remove obstructions and tangles off the brush roll, and other components of the vacuum-mop combination units.
